Suggest a better descriptionPreheat oven to350F. Lightly grease cookie sheets; set aside. Heat chocolate and shortening in2-quart sauce pan over low heat, stirring constantly, until melted; remove from heat. Mix in sugar, vanilla and eggs. Blend in flour, baking powder and salt. Stir in 2/3 cup "M&Ms"(r) Milk Chocolate Mini Baking Bits. For each cookie, arrange 3 pecan halves, with ends almost touching at center, on prepared cookie sheets. Drop dough by rounded teaspoonfuls onto center of each group of pecans; mound the dough slightly. Bake 8 to 10 minutes just until set; do not over bake. Immediately remove cookies to wire racks to cool completely. Top each cookie with frosting; press remaining "M&Ms"(r) Milk Chocolate Mini Baking Bits into frosting to create turtle shell.. Notes: These chewy little turtles are as fun to eat as they are to make! MAKES ABOUT 2 1/2 DOZEN COOKIES Recipe by: Mars Recipe by 1996 Mars, Incorporated Posted to brand-name-recipes by Barbra
